The regulations in this part relate to that portion of Section 38, Arms Export Control Act of 1976, as amended, which is concerned with the importation of arms, ammunition and implements of war. This part contains the U.S. Munitions Import List and includes procedural and administrative requirements and provisions relating to registration of importers, permits, articles in transit, import certification, delivery verification, import restrictions applicable to certain countries, exemptions, U.S. military firearms or ammunition, penalties, seizures, and forfeitures. All designations and changes in designation of articles subject to import control under Section 414 of the Mutual Security Act of 1954, as amended, have the concurrence of the Secretary of State and the Secretary of Defense.
